Output 33aa8356ace904b9358f648943cf6b109adb40280c1b251429d8b7f956f01855:0

value
3469978263
script pubkey
OP_0 OP_PUSHBYTES_20 3dfe0e69c13e9817622281c5d2555942cff1c666
address
tb1q8hlqu6wp86vpwc3zs8zay42egt8lr3nx2ap6c3
transaction
33aa8356ace904b9358f648943cf6b109adb40280c1b251429d8b7f956f01855
confirmations
215907
spent
true